- Aleuron_ypanemae abstract "Aleuron ypanemae is a moth of the Sphingidae family. It was described by Boisduval in 1875. It is known from Brazil.There are probably multiple generations per year.The larvae feed on Doliocarpus dentatus and Curatella americana, and probably also other Dilleniaceae species.".
